在日常使用电脑的过程中,我们可能会遇到需要批量修改文件后缀名的情况。比如,将多个文件从“.doc”统一改为“.txt”,或者将图片文件的格式进行转换等。虽然Windows 10本身并没有提供直接的批量操作功能,但通过一些简单的方法,我们可以轻松实现这一需求。
方法一:使用资源管理器重命名
1. 选择目标文件
打开资源管理器,找到需要修改后缀名的文件夹,按住Ctrl键逐个点击需要修改的文件,或者按住Shift键选择连续的文件。
2. 批量重命名
右键单击选中的文件,选择“重命名”。此时你会发现所有选中的文件都会共享同一个名称框。
3. 输入新的后缀名
在名称框中输入新的文件后缀名(例如“.jpg”),然后按下Enter键。所有选中的文件会自动更新为新的后缀名。
这种方法适用于文件名相同或相似的文件,但如果文件名不同,则可能导致覆盖问题。因此,在操作前建议备份重要文件。
方法二:借助PowerShell脚本
对于更复杂的批量修改需求,可以利用PowerShell的强大功能来完成。
1. 打开PowerShell
按下Win+X组合键,选择“Windows PowerShell(管理员)”。
2. 导航到目标文件夹
输入以下命令切换到包含目标文件的目录:
```
cd "D:\目标文件夹路径"
```
3. 执行批量重命名
使用以下命令将所有“.txt”文件改为“.log”:
```
Rename-Item -Path .txt -NewName { $_.Name -replace '\.txt$','.log' }
```
如果需要同时处理多个文件类型,可以根据实际需求调整正则表达式。
4. 验证结果
返回文件夹查看是否成功修改。
PowerShell的优势在于它可以处理复杂的逻辑和条件,适合高级用户。
方法三:使用第三方工具
如果不想手动操作,也可以下载一些专门的文件管理工具,如“Total Commander”、“Bulk Rename Utility”等。这些软件提供了直观的界面和丰富的功能,能够快速完成批量文件重命名任务。
以“Bulk Rename Utility”为例:
1. 下载并安装该工具。
2. 打开软件,添加需要修改的文件。
3. 设置过滤条件和新的后缀名。
4. 点击“Rename”按钮即可完成操作。
这类工具的优点是操作简便,适合不熟悉代码或命令行的用户。
注意事项
- 备份数据:在执行批量修改之前,务必对文件进行备份,以防误操作导致数据丢失。
- 检查文件类型:确保修改后的后缀名与文件的实际内容匹配,否则可能无法正常打开。
- 避免重复命名冲突:如果文件名相同,批量重命名时可能会导致文件被覆盖,需提前规划好文件名结构。
通过以上方法,你可以轻松地在Win10系统中批量修改文件后缀名,无论是简单的文件格式转换还是复杂的批量处理,都能得心应手。希望本文对你有所帮助!